Strong's H102 (Hebrew)

Hebrew: אַגָּף (ʼaggâph)

Pronunciation: ag-gawf'

Morphology: n-m

Derivation: probably from נָגַף (nâgaph) H5062 (through the idea of impending); a cover or heap; i.e. (only plural) wings of an army, or crowds of troops

KJV Renderings: bands

Senses

  1. wing (of an army), band, army, hordes
